Answer:

x = 5

which agrees with the first answer option listed

Step-by-step explanation:

Use the proportionality associated with similar triangles, considering that the larger triangle has sides:

x + (x+5) = 2 x + 5

and

(x+1) + (x-2) = 2 x - 1

and the smaller triangle:

x   and  (x-2)

The we build the following proportionality:

(2 x + 5) / x  = (2 x - 1) / (x - 2)

cross multiply to eliminate denominators:

(2 x + 5) (x - 2) = x (2 x - 1)

operate:

2 x^2 - 4 x + 5 x -10 = 2 x^2 - x

combine like terms:

2 x^2 + x -10 = 2 x^2 - x

subtract 2 x^2 from both sides:

x - 10 = - x

add x to both sides:

2 x  -10 = 0

add 10 to both sides

2 x= 10

divide both sides by 2:

x = 5

which agrees with the first answer option listed

Find the lateral surface area of the figure.
Brut [27]

Surface area of the cylinder = 816.4 sq. ft.

Solution:

Height of the cylinder = 21 ft

Diameter of the cylinder = 10 ft

Radius of the cylinder = 10 ÷ 2 = 5 ft

Use the value of \pi = 3.14

Surface area of the cylinder = 2 \pi r h+2 \pi r^{2}

Substitute the given values in the surface area formula, we get

Surface area of the cylinder $=2\times3.14\times 5\times 21+2 \times3.14\times 5^2

                                               =659.4+157

                                               =816.4 ft²

Hence the surface area of the cylinder is 816.4 sq. ft.
